
Ingredients
- Scotch1 1/2 oz
- LimeJuice of 1/2
- Powdered sugar1/2 tsp
- Lemon1/2 slice
- Cherry1
Instructions
Shake scotch, juice of lime, and powdered sugar with ice and strain into a whiskey sour glass. Decorate with 1/2 slice lemon, top with the cherry, and serve.

Expert Tips
Fresh Citrus Tip
Always squeeze fresh citrus juice rather than using bottled. Roll the fruit on the counter before cutting to release more juice, and strain out seeds and pulp for a smoother drink.
Sweetener Tip
Make your own simple syrup by dissolving equal parts sugar and hot water. It mixes more smoothly than granulated sugar and allows precise sweetness control.
